Jackal Squad are a group of thieves and Mercenaries consisting entirely of Jackals in the Sonic the Hedgehog franchise. Lead by the self-proclaimed "Ultimate Mercenary", Infinite (Who's actual name used during his service with them is unknown). They are minor supporting antagonists for Sonic Forces, specifically it's prequel media like the Prequel comics and the Episode Shadow DLC.
History
Past
Not much is known about the Squad's past apart from being a gang of thieves and mercenaries working for money. One day they are tasked with raiding Dr. Eggman's base in Mystic Jungle and selling off his tech for money. Eggman (who just discovered the Phantom Ruby), accidentally triggers it, causing it to summon an army of Badnik replicas. With this newfound power, he attempts to defend his base from Jackal Squad to no avail, eventually their leader manages to reach Eggman and goes to deal the final blow, but then comes into contact with the Ruby which causes him to hallucinate a ruined world where he rules as an overlord. Seeing the potential in him, Eggman offers him and his squad to join him as one of the leaders of the Eggman Army. Although the rest of the Jackals were against this offer, The leader accepts.
Sonic Forces: Episode Shadow
Eggman becomes so obsessed with studying the Phantom Ruby and it's power that he becomes negligible to create more Badniks to defend his base. Because of this, Eggman hires the rest of Jackal Squad to protect his base while he does his studies. This attracts the attention of Team Dark, who send Shadow the Hedgehog to raid Eggmans base. When he begins to approach the Bases perimeters, He is attacked by most of the Jackal Squad except for their leader, who Shadow ploughs through killing them in the process. Enraged at Shadow for his squad's death, the Leader attacks Shadow. Shadow effortlessly defeats him and tells him he never wants to see his face again before teleporting away. After his defeat and he realises his fear of Shadow, his inferiority complex is triggered causing him to go insane.
With the tests completed, Eggman gives the Phantom Ruby to the now sole Jackal, granting him ultimate power. The Jackal then dons a mask to hide his face and assumes the identity of Infinite, as we know him today.
